Design Features

The obverse of the Geneva 9 deniers 1715 coin features the inscription "IHS" above "RESPUBL GENEVEN," symbolizing the religious and civic pride of the Geneva citizens. On the reverse side, the inscription "IHS" is accompanied by "POST TENE-BRAS LUX," which translates to "Light after Darkness," signifying hope and enlightenment.

Technical Specifications

This silver coin weighs 1.23 grams and has a diameter of 18.00mm, making it a small yet intricate piece of numismatic art. Crafted from billon (silver alloy), the Geneva 9 deniers coin showcases the skilled craftsmanship of the minters during the Republic of Geneva era.
